For catching shad at night any light will work, even a flashlight. Hand-held spotlights work great. If you can get the shad to gather in the light then turn it off they become disoriented and that is the moment to throw the net.
If you want to catch other kinds if bait fish and have access to a dock with power try hanging a bug zapper light over the water. As the bugs drop down into the water all kinds of bait fish come around. One throw of the net and you have a load of bait...W
